In Memory of Mallie Breuer.

Mallie Ann Breuer was born June 10, 1986, in Breckenridge, to Steven and Robin (Nold) Breuer. She grew up on the family farm near Mooreton, N.D., graduating from Wahpeton High School in 2004. Mallie was baptized and received her First Holy Communion at St. Anthony’s Catholic Church in Mooreton and received the Sacrament of Confirmation at St. Mary’s Cathedral in Fargo.

She furthered her education obtaining her Associate of Science in Nursing degree and was most recently employed at the St. Francis Nursing Home in Breckenridge as a Licensed Practical Nurse. She resided in Mooreton.

As a high school student, Mallie was involved in volleyball, track, basketball and softball. Mallie continued to stay active by participating in recreational softball, volleyball, walking and running but most of all, she loved to dance. Mallie enjoyed spending quality time not only with her brothers, but also her nieces and nephews; attending family gatherings, helping out on the family farm and cherishing her relationships with her many, many friends.

To know Mallie was to love her. Mallie had an incredible zest for life. She touched everyone’s heart with her unforgettable smile and infectious laughter.

Mallie is survived by her parents, Robin Breuer and Steven Breuer; her brothers, Stephen (Aleshia) Breuer, Ryan Breuer, Timothy Breuer and Tyler Breuer; her nieces Jude and Ellie Joyce; her nephews, Josiah and Jaxon; her grandparents, Robert and Mary Joyce Breuer and William and Mary Nold; her godparents, Theresa Breuer and Vince Lentz; and her many aunts, uncles and cousins.

Mallie was preceded in death by her Uncle Joe Breuer; and her great-grandmothers, Eleanor Orstad, Mildred McLeod and Helen Nold.
